This Export Contracts Manager role is focused on leading the Sales Administration team while managing commercial contracts for complex, international deals. The Export Contracts Manager will be the go-to expert for trade finance, credit terms, and logistics. The Export Contracts Manager will play a central role in ensuring smooth customer fulfilment while driving operational excellence across the department.

Package: £70,000–£85,000 basic salary, 25 days holiday + bank holidays, bonus scheme.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Lead the Sales Administration team (8 people), including 2 direct reports
  • Negotiate and draft complex commercial contracts, ensuring compliance with sanctions and legal standards
  • Manage trade finance instruments like Letters of Credit and bonds in partnership with the group COE
  • Oversee logistics for large-scale projects, ensuring contract compliance and customer satisfaction
  • Coordinate invoicing, shipment, and payment processes to ensure they are completed within terms
  • Maintain strong relationships with external banks, ECAs, and shipping agents
  • Drive internal process improvements and monitor KPIs and departmental budget
  • Advise on credit terms and attend monthly debtors meetings

Candidate Profile:

  • Strong background in commercial contracts
  • Some experience with Export process
  • Experience managing customer service or sales administration teams
  • Excellent negotiation, influencing, and analytical skills
  • Comfortable working cross-functionally in a matrix environment
  • Familiar with regions like sub-Saharan Africa or Egypt is advantageous
  • Graduate membership of the Institute of Export is a plus
